ParticipantDoes anyone have / could share the calculations for converting % w/v to mg/Kg using the average weight of the cockroaches. I wrote the flow chart down but i must have missed something along the way and i am throughly confused where the cockroach weight fits into it all.
May 24, 2018 at 9:40 pm #44127Samira Aili
ParticipantHi Samuel,
You add it in once it’s at mg/ul. For example, the one we went through was 0.00028mg/uL which would mean that it’s the same as 0.00028mg/cockroach weight (we had 0.1g), then you convert to mg/ kg.May 24, 2018 at 11:26 pm #44136Ken Rodgers
